🌱 Understanding Stress and Anxiety
Stress is the body’s response to challenging situations, while anxiety is a feeling of worry or fear about future events. While occasional stress is normal, chronic stress and prolonged anxiety can lead to serious health problems, including high blood pressure, heart disease, depression, and weakened immunity. Recognizing the symptoms—such as irritability, sleep disturbances, fatigue, and difficulty concentrating—is the first step in effective management.
🧘 Mindfulness and Meditation
Mindfulness and meditation are among the most effective techniques for reducing stress and anxiety. Practicing mindfulness involves focusing on the present moment without judgment. Meditation techniques such as deep breathing, body scans, and guided imagery help calm the mind, reduce tension, and lower stress hormone levels. Many Americans use apps and online platforms to guide daily mindfulness sessions, making these practices accessible even with a busy schedule.
🏃 Physical Activity
Regular physical activity is a powerful stress-reliever. Exercise releases endorphins, which are natural mood boosters, and helps reduce the physical effects of stress, such as muscle tension and elevated heart rate. Activities like walking, running, yoga, swimming, or cycling are popular ways to manage stress in the USA. Even short daily exercise sessions can significantly improve mood and energy levels.
📝 Journaling and Cognitive Techniques
Journaling is a simple but effective method for processing emotions and reducing anxiety. Writing about worries, goals, or daily experiences can provide clarity and perspective. Cognitive techniques, such as reframing negative thoughts, identifying triggers, and practicing gratitude, are also highly effective. These methods help individuals manage stress by changing the way they perceive and react to challenging situations.
💤 Sleep and Relaxation
Adequate sleep is crucial for stress and anxiety management. Americans are increasingly aware of the importance of 7–9 hours of quality sleep per night. Poor sleep can exacerbate anxiety and reduce the ability to cope with stress. Relaxation techniques such as progressive muscle relaxation, deep breathing, and listening to calming music before bed can improve sleep quality and overall mental health.
💬 Social Support
Social connections play a vital role in managing stress and anxiety. Talking to friends, family members, or support groups provides emotional relief and perspective. In the USA, mental health professionals, counseling centers, and online communities offer additional support for individuals dealing with high stress or anxiety levels. Building a strong support network helps reduce feelings of isolation and promotes emotional resilience.
🌿 Holistic and Alternative Approaches
Many Americans incorporate holistic practices into stress management routines. Techniques such as aromatherapy, massage therapy, acupuncture, and herbal supplements like chamomile or valerian root are commonly used to complement traditional approaches. These methods help relax the body, improve sleep, and reduce anxiety naturally.
🌀 Practical Tips for Daily Stress Management
- Prioritize Tasks: Focus on what is most important to reduce overwhelm.
- Take Breaks: Short breaks during work or study periods improve focus and reduce tension.
- Limit Screen Time: Reducing exposure to social media and news helps prevent mental fatigue.
- Practice Self-Care: Engage in hobbies, physical activity, or relaxation routines regularly.
- Seek Professional Help: Therapists and counselors can provide guidance and strategies for long-term stress management.
